Saga boats
Saga has a long history in building boats. Founded in 1960 with the aim to build boats of high quality and good seaworthiness. Local tradition of excellent craftsmanship is the main focus.
The yard
Saga Boats uses its own knowledge, reinforced by close collaboration with leading designers. Since the early 1980s the program has been expanded with semi-planing boats. The quality is of great importance to ensure seaworthiness. This gives Saga a common identity and strengthens the brand name Saga. It has resulted in a high second-hand value of the ships. A large part of the annual production is exported to the European market. Sweden, Finland, Denmark, England, Germany, the Netherlands, Russia, Switzerland and of course Norway itself. Saga is a quality label in both Norway and Europe.
SAGA 325
The Saga 325 is a very well thought-out concept and therefore also a real space wonder with its 4 fixed beds.
In the saloon is the helm, a spacious round seat, two large boating places and a luxurious combuis which is easily accessible from the spacious open cockpit. The large windows in the salon offer a good view on all sides. The large sliding windows in combination with the side windows that can be opened on both sides, as well as the large sliding doors give you the feeling of an open boat on beautiful summer days. In addition, there is a spacious bathroom with a good headroom, equipped with shower and electric toilet.
The salon is very spacious and light with full headroom. The U-shaped seating area can accommodate 6 people. Because all seats are at the same height as the driver's seat, all passengers have a clear view in all directions. The front section of the seating group can easily be converted into a double co-driver seat. By tilting the driver's seat, you can create extra bench space. The driver's seat is ergonomically designed to allow full control of all operations. The design was made with focus on functionality and clean lines. The combuis is equipped with an oven and the 85 liter refrigerator is standard. Furthermore, there is sufficient space for kitchen utensils and food present in the combuis.
The aft deck can be supplied with an L-bank and a removable table. Under the aft deck are accessible cargo spaces with a lot of space. The design of the swim platform provides an easy and safe entry. The steps at the side of the swim platform provide easy access to the aft deck. The aft deck is equipped with a canopy where a tent can easily be mounted.
This type of Saga is an ideal ship to explore the outer waters because of its high seaworthiness (CE-B). Of course you can also sail very well in the smaller inland waters because the ship is also very steady during the slow sailing because the ship is in possession of a continuous keel. The deep keel is a semi-planning model. The polyester hull is manufactured by means of vacuum injection which makes the ship light but also solid and strong.
All in all a nice boat for a longer stay on the water.
